当我们在电子表格软件中输入计算公式后,偶尔会遇到单元格内没有呈现预期数值,而是呈现一片空白或错误提示的情形。这种现象通常意味着公式本身虽然被系统接受,但由于某些环节的阻碍,未能成功执行并输出有效结果。理解其背后的原因并掌握排查方法,对于保障数据处理的流畅性与准确性至关重要。
核心问题概述 公式结果不显示数据,本质上是一种计算输出异常。它不等同于公式报错,因为软件可能并未返回“值!”或“名称?”等明确错误代码,而是让单元格保持“看似正常”的空置状态。这往往更具隐蔽性,容易让使用者误以为计算已完成,实则数据链存在断点。 主要成因分类 导致这一状况的原因可归为几个主要方向。首先是数据源问题,例如公式所引用的单元格本身为空,或包含不可见的空格等字符。其次是计算设置问题,比如工作簿被意外设置为“手动计算”模式,导致公式未及时更新。再者是格式冲突问题,单元格的数字格式可能被设置为“文本”,从而抑制了公式结果的数值显示。最后,公式逻辑本身也可能存在缺陷,例如引用范围错误或使用了不匹配的函数参数。 基础解决思路 面对此问题,使用者可遵循一套基础排查流程。应先检查公式引用的原始数据区域是否完整有效。接着,确认整个工作簿的计算选项是否为“自动”。然后,审视目标单元格的格式设置,确保其并非文本格式。若以上均无问题,则需逐步核验公式的书写逻辑与函数应用是否正确。通过这种由表及里、从数据到设置的顺序检查,大多数不显示结果的问题都能得到定位与解决。在电子表格软件的使用过程中,精心构建的公式未能呈现出应有的计算结果,仅留下一片空白,确实会令人感到困惑与挫败。这种“无声的故障”比直接的错误提示更需警惕,因为它可能让存在缺陷的数据分析悄然通过。要系统性地解决此问题,我们需要深入理解其背后的多层次原因,并掌握一套结构化的排查与修复方法。
成因一:源头数据存在瑕疵 公式的运算如同烹饪,食材不佳则难出美味。首先,最直接的原因是公式所引用的单元格本身内容无效。这并非单指单元格为空,有时单元格内可能包含肉眼难以察觉的字符,例如通过复制粘贴引入的非打印空格、换行符或单引号。特别是当单元格左上角显示绿色三角标记时,常提示该单元格以文本形式存储数字,公式将其视为文本而非数值,导致计算失效。此外,若引用区域使用了其他函数(如查找函数)且该函数未能找到匹配项而返回错误,也可能致使外层公式整体无输出。 成因二:软件计算模式与选项设置干扰 软件的环境设置是控制公式生命的“开关”。一个常见但易被忽略的情况是,工作簿被设置为“手动计算”模式。在此模式下,更改数据后,公式不会自动重算,结果便会停留在上一次计算的状态,若上次计算时引用数据为空,则结果显示也为空。用户需主动按下计算键(通常是F9)才能更新。另外,某些高级选项,如“迭代计算”若被误开启且设置不当,也可能导致某些循环引用公式无法收敛,从而无法输出稳定结果。检查“公式”选项卡下的“计算选项”是解决问题的关键步骤。 成因三:单元格格式设置产生冲突 单元格的格式如同一个展示柜,决定了内容以何种面貌呈现。如果单元格的格式预先被设置为“文本”,那么无论在其中输入什么公式或数字,软件都会将其当作普通文字处理,公式不会被计算,数字也无法参与运算。同样,若单元格格式为“自定义”且定义了特殊的格式代码,有时也会意外屏蔽正常数值的显示。解决方法是选中问题单元格,将其格式更改为“常规”或相应的数值格式(如数值、货币等),然后再次激活单元格(双击进入编辑状态后按回车键)以触发重新计算。 成因四:公式自身逻辑与引用存在缺陷 公式本身的结构性问题是根本所在。其一,引用范围可能不正确,例如在求和公式中,引用范围包含了本应排除的标题行或空白列,导致求和区域实际无效。其二,函数使用不当,例如在使用“如果”函数时,未妥善处理“假值”情况下的返回值,可能留空。其三,数组公式输入不完整,对于需要按特定组合键确认的数组公式,若仅按回车键结束,可能导致公式无法完整运算。其四,公式中使用了易失性函数或跨工作簿引用,当外部链接不可达或数据更新不及时时,结果也会显示异常。 系统化诊断与解决方案 面对公式不显示结果的问题,建议采用分层递进的诊断流程。第一步,进行“数据源健康度检查”。选中公式引用的单元格,观察编辑栏中的实际内容,利用“查找与选择”功能中的“定位条件”来快速定位是否存在以文本形式存储的数字。第二步,执行“计算环境确认”。前往“公式”菜单,确保“计算选项”设置为“自动”。对于大型复杂工作簿,可尝试使用“计算工作表”功能进行局部强制重算。第三步,实施“格式重置操作”。全选或选中相关单元格区域,将其数字格式统一重置为“常规”,然后通过简单的编辑操作(如按F2再回车)来刷新单元格状态。第四步,开展“公式逻辑审计”。使用软件内置的“公式求值”功能,逐步执行公式计算,观察每一步的中间结果,精准定位计算在哪一环节中断或返回了空值。对于复杂嵌套公式,可尝试将其分解为多个辅助列,分步验证每个部分的输出。 进阶情形与预防措施 除了上述常见情况,还有一些进阶场景。例如,在使用某些数据库函数或引用定义了名称的范围时,若名称定义失效或引用范围为空,公式结果也会为空。又或者,当工作表或单元格被意外设置了“隐藏”或“保护”属性,虽然不影响计算,但可能影响显示,需检查相关设置。为预防问题发生,良好的操作习惯至关重要:在构建公式前,先确保数据源的清洁与规范;重要公式旁可添加备注说明其逻辑;定期使用“错误检查”功能对工作表进行扫描;对于关键数据模型,建立备份版本以防止误操作。 总而言之,公式结果不显示并非无解难题,而是一个提醒我们关注数据完整性与设置细节的信号。通过从数据源头、软件设置、格式配置到公式逻辑的全面排查,使用者不仅能解决眼前的问题,更能深化对电子表格运算机制的理解,从而提升数据处理的整体效能与可靠性。
50人看过